Free Sex - With a podcast name that is certainly going to raise eyebrows, this is the latest podcast by Adam Zmith, one of the creators of the award-winning LGBTQ history podcast The Log Books and author of the recent book Deep Sniff: A History of Poppers and Queer Futures.

In this new series, Zmith poses a simple question: why aren’t we having the sex that we want? This series explores how society can be holding us back, from the rise of sexually transmitted infections to gay shame. There’s a discussion on the funding shortfalls and political discussions around sex and the importance of nighttime welfare. 

The podcast is supported by its listeners via Substack, which you can support by heading to their site. As a side-note, it is interesting to see how Substack is being used as a way to build up revenue.
